Transaction 323c49adfac8393bb45f28cba3a9b12db4c505ff3d18922907180fc948b01566

3 Input
2 Outputs
  • 323c49adfac8393bb45f28cba3a9b12db4c505ff3d18922907180fc948b01566:0
  • value  1855500000
    address  3NVpZoF8WWcZLqBt8oZMyu75UjiHhuugGV
  • 323c49adfac8393bb45f28cba3a9b12db4c505ff3d18922907180fc948b01566:1
  • value  117273232
    address  365o9AFHreVAKBpWruqBnKj9dST2KvMkzS